#AIImpactOnForex The future of high-frequency trading (HFT) is deeply intertwined with advancements in artificial intelligence. As AI algorithms become more sophisticated, they will likely enable even faster and more precise execution of trades, capitalizing on fleeting micro-price movements with greater accuracy. Expect to see AI systems capable of identifying and reacting to complex market signals in fractions of a millisecond, potentially leveraging techniques like reinforcement learning for optimal decision-making in ultra-low latency environments. Furthermore, AI could enhance risk management within HFT by more accurately predicting and mitigating potential adverse price swings. The ability of AI to process massive datasets and identify subtle correlations might lead to the discovery of novel HFT strategies that are currently beyond human or traditional algorithmic capabilities. However, this evolution will also likely necessitate advancements in infrastructure and regulatory frameworks to ensure market stability and fairness.
